Least-squares 3×3 from Camera A RGB → target on the 24 ColorChecker patches under the current illuminant. Per-patch Δ shows where a linear map fails; the optional .cube adds an IDW residual so on-chart colours land closer than matrix alone. Educational — not a lab camera profile.

Adobe/IRIDAS lattice (R varies fastest). Domain covers the fit samples (0 → max src). Residual mode is tighter on the chart; matrix-only is an exact linear bake of the 3×3.
